Hypothalamic-pituitary-gonadal axis stimulatory and inhibitory signals. There are many disorders that may impact the ability for a woman to ovulate normally. This hormone then binds to another area of the brain called the pituitary gland and leads to the release of FSH (follicle stimulating hormone), a hormone that directly binds to cells in the ovary, leading to egg growth and maturation.

Unlike IVF, in which actual fertilization is observed and confirmed in the laboratory, GIFT does not allow visual confirmation of fertilization.
